The Historical Heart of Lecco

Lecco's historical heart, known as the Centro Storico, is a labyrinthine maze of cobblestone streets lined with charming boutiques, cozy cafés, and ancient churches. Here, you'll discover hidden courtyards and picturesque squares that evoke the town's rich past. Piazza Cermenati, the main square, is a vibrant hub of activity, surrounded by historical buildings and dotted with inviting outdoor cafés.

The Mountain Majesty of Monte Resegone

Towering over Lecco, Monte Resegone is a majestic mountain that offers breathtaking panoramic views of the town and Lake Como. Hiking trails of varying difficulty lead to its summit, rewarding adventurers with unforgettable vistas that extend far into the horizon. Whether you prefer a leisurely stroll or a challenging ascent, Monte Resegone is a must-visit for nature enthusiasts and photographers alike.

The Artistic Treasures of Villa Manzoni

Once the summer residence of the renowned Italian novelist Alessandro Manzoni, Villa Manzoni is now a museum that houses a fascinating collection of memorabilia and personal belongings. The villa's elegant rooms provide a glimpse into the life and work of one of Italy's greatest literary figures. Visitors can also explore the lush gardens, where Manzoni is said to have found inspiration for his masterpiece "The Betrothed".

The Culinary Delights of Lecco

Lecco's culinary scene is a testament to the region's rich agricultural heritage. Local restaurants serve up authentic Lombard dishes, showcasing the freshest lake fish, local cheeses, and homemade pasta. Traditional trattorias offer a warm and inviting ambiance, where guests can savor the flavors of homemade specialties. Don't miss the opportunity to sample "reségada", a sweet pastry unique to Lecco and named after the iconic mountain.

The Charm of Varenna

Just a short ferry ride from Lecco lies the enchanting village of Varenna. With its colorful houses clinging to steep cliffs, Varenna is a postcard-perfect destination that epitomizes the beauty of Lake Como. Explore its narrow streets, visit the charming 11th-century Church of San Giorgio, and lose yourself in the picturesque views from the waterfront promenade.

The Greenway of the Lake

For those who enjoy active pursuits, the Greenway of the Lake is an unmissable attraction. This scenic walking and cycling path stretches for over 20 kilometers, connecting Lecco to other towns and villages along the eastern shore of Lake Como. The path offers breathtaking lake views, passes through ancient forests, and provides a unique perspective on the region's natural beauty.
